Heavy Duty Pressure Controls

MBC 5100, Block-type compact pressure switches for marine applications.
MBC pressure switches are used in marine applications where space and reliability are the most important features. MBCs are compact pressure switches, designed according to our new block design to survive in the harsh conditions known from machine rooms onboard ships.
MBCs have high vibration resistance and feature all commonly marine approvals. The fixed, but low differential guarantees accurate monitoring of critical pressures.
MBV test valves can be delivered as standard option for MBC pressure switches.
Features
• Designed for use in severe industrial environments
• High vibration stability
• Part of the Danfoss block system,  consisting of MBC pressure controls, MBS pressure transmitters and MBV test valves
• MBC 5100 with all major ship approvals
• High repeatability
• Optimal compact design for machine building purposes
• Intended for alarm indication, shut down, control and diagnostics in many applications - motors, gears, thrusters, pumps, filters, compressors etc.

Performance
Bellows versions ± 0.2 % FS (typ.)
± 0.5 % FS (max.)
Diaphragm versions ± 0.5 % FS (typ.)
± 1 % FS (max.)
Piston versions ± 1 % FS (typ.)
± 1 % FS (max.)
Response time < 4 ms
Max. switch frequency 10/min (0.16 Hz)
Differential -
Permissible operating pressure -
Burst pressure -
Life time Mechanical for diaphragm and bellows > 400,000 cycles
Mechanical for piston type >1 million cycles
Electrical at max. contact load > 100,000 cycles

Electrical specifications
Switch       SPDT
Contact load AC 1 10 A, 250 V AC 15 0.5A, 250 V
AC 3 3A, 250 V DC 13 12 W, 125 V

Environmental conditions
Temperature Operation Bellows versions -40 - +85 °C
Diaphragm versions -10 - +85 °C
Piston versions -40 - +85 °C
Transport Bellows versions -50 - +85 °C
Diaphragm versions -50 - +85 °C
Piston versions -40 - +85 °C
Enclosure     IP 65, IEC 529
Vibration stability Hz Sinusoidal 20 g, 25 Hz - 2 kHz IEC 68-2-6
Piston versions 4.4g, 25-200 IEC 60068-2-27
Shock resistence Shock 50 g/6 ms, IEC 60068-2-27
Free fall   IEC 68-2-32
